Includes an ANSI Type 2 or IEC 62056-21 optical port, RS-232, and RS-485 (multi-drop). It also supports internal modem options for GPRS/GSM and protocols like Modbus and DNP3.

Nominal 57V to 240V (phase-to-neutral), 3-phase 4-wire or 3-phase 3-wire systems.
